Transaction 881ab3bdcee07f57b190bc22e749f9390c79f85399649963f719913a9c4c506e

4 Input
2 Outputs
  • 881ab3bdcee07f57b190bc22e749f9390c79f85399649963f719913a9c4c506e:0
  • value  5000000
    address  3NhrARaaLaaop5yy8dvkugvgTh3czs5F8c
  • 881ab3bdcee07f57b190bc22e749f9390c79f85399649963f719913a9c4c506e:1
  • value  19692210
    address  b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2